This application provides an ion implantation method for a semiconductor structure, relating to the field of semiconductor technology. The semiconductor structure ion implantation method includes: providing a substrate having a deep trench; forming a first positive photoresist layer on the surface of the substrate; performing a first exposure using a first exposure dose to expose the first positive photoresist layer at the bottom of the deep trench; forming a second positive photoresist layer on the surface of the first positive photoresist layer; performing a second exposure using a second exposure dose less than the first exposure dose; performing a first development on the first and second positive photoresist layers to form an implantation window; and performing ion implantation on the substrate through the implantation window. This semiconductor structure ion implantation method addresses the problem of achieving precise ion implantation at the bottom of deep trenches in semiconductor devices.

Composite film material for circuit board manufacturing process and preparation method thereof, and selective via hole method for circuit board

The application discloses a composite film material for a circuit board process, a preparation method of the composite film material, and a circuit board selective hole plugging method. The composite film material comprises a metal layer, a photosensitive layer arranged on a first surface of the metal layer, and a resin bonding layer arranged on a second surface of the metal layer. The resin bonding layer comprises an alkali-soluble resin and is used for bonding with the circuit board. The application uses the strong support of the metal layer and a specific formula design of the resin bonding layer to ensure that the film material can be cleaned and removed without residues by an alkaline solvent after experiencing an extreme heat process of 150 DEG C to 220 DEG C, and the yield and surface flatness of a selective hole plugging process of a high thickness-diameter ratio circuit board are significantly improved.

Generator set early warning method and system based on DCS data

The invention relates to the technical field of generator set early warning, and discloses a generator set early warning method and system based on DCS data. The method comprises the steps that real-time data of DCS process variables of the generator set are collected, data subsets are divided according to operation conditions, and a dynamic self-adaptive reference contour is established for each subset; an instantaneous anomaly index is quantified by calculating a multi-dimensional distance between real-time data and a reference contour, and an accumulated situation index reflecting anomaly persistence is constructed. And identifying an early performance degradation mode by analyzing the growth slope and curvature change of the index, and accordingly, matching an early warning strategy and dynamically updating the reference contour. And finally, a comprehensive health degree score is generated, and self-adaptive early warning threshold adjustment is realized. According to the method, the problem of false alarm of a fixed threshold value under a variable working condition is effectively solved through the dynamic reference model, sensitive capture of early performance degradation symptoms is realized through deep analysis of an abnormal trend, and the accuracy and timeliness of early warning are improved.

A Multi-Objective Optimization-Based Reverse Design Method for Wharf Foundation Piles

This invention provides a reverse design method for wharf foundation piles based on multi-objective optimization, belonging to the field of civil engineering structural design technology. In the composite load space composed of vertical, horizontal loads, and bending moments, this invention uses a shape parameter vector containing dimensions and coupling coefficients to define and parameterize the target failure envelope. By performing numerical limit state analysis and fitting on design samples, the actual shape parameters are obtained. This is used to train a machine learning model that can quickly predict the shape of the corresponding envelope from the design parameters. Using the difference between the predicted shape and the target shape as the optimization objective, and combined with construction costs, the model is used to evaluate candidate designs. A multi-objective optimization algorithm is used iteratively to obtain a set of design parameters that optimally balance performance and cost. The selected design is verified through high-precision simulation. After confirming that its actual performance matches the target, the parameters and performance information are integrated into a standard digital file to directly drive automated construction.
